## Handover: fuel-usage report job

Hey — welcome aboard. The Wagontail fleet fuel-usage report runs every Monday at 05:00 and lands in the ops dashboard by 06:30. It's mostly hands-off, but watch for the odometer-gap warning; it means a truck's telemetry feed dropped mid-week and the numbers will look suspiciously good. If the job stalls, just rerun it — it's idempotent. Depot mappings live in the Harkfield repo. Everything the job reads at startup is captured in the block below.

deployment values, kajep-kageg:
[praix]
host = praix.paliqcorp.corp
user = praix_svc
database = praix_prod

## Deployment

Welcome to Trailform! Offline mode is the whole point: surveyors sync when they're back in range, so the sync daemon must be deployed alongside the app server. Build the bundle, push it to the device fleet, and restart the daemon. For local testing, the daemon expects the following configuration.

settings of bafof-fajog:
[aldix]
port = 9300
region = north-3
host = aldix.kelvilabs.example
team = istath
timeout_ms = 1500
retries = 8

## Ticket: Legacy ORM Refactor (Ormwell)

The legacy Ormwell mapping layer is being replaced; plugin hooks on the old session API are deprecated as of the next minor. Migrate to the adapter interface before then. Test only against pipeline-stamped builds — local builds lack the shim. Reference the current stamped build token, shown below.

pipeline stamp: htk31_f769b577b3028a4e9958e5bb8d1259a

## Formula sandbox tuning

User-supplied formulas in Gridmoor execute inside a restricted interpreter with hard ceilings on time, memory, and call depth. Reviewers should confirm any change to these ceilings is justified in the PR description, since raising them widens the abuse surface. Defaults were chosen from production traces. The current limits are as follows.

limits module of tafog-fawip:
WEIGHTS = {
    "julix": 57,
    "lamys": 992,
    "kasvan": 209,
    "quenok": 750,
    "alddor": 259,
    "oliath": 1009,
    "wenix": 815,
}